TEAS Testing Information
ATI, the company that offers the TEAS test at OCC, is using Version 5, and you should look for study guides that reference this version. The TEAS test must be taken at OCC. We will not accept TEAS tests from other testing facilities.
To improve your chances of success on this test, take your general education courses first. The TEAS test
consists of reading, math, science, and English. If you wish, take the review class.
- Students must take and pass the TEAS test in order to receive a date of completion from Admissions.
- It is recommended that students take the TEAS test when they are finished with their general education requirements.
- Students must pass at a "Proficient" or "Above Proficient" level.
- Students can take the TEAS test a maximum of three (3) times: Initial test - first time; retest 1 which students are required to enroll in and complete the TEAS prep course prior to taking retest 1; retest 2 which requires a mandatory 6 week waiting period prior to taking retest 2.
- There is a mandatory 2 year waiting period for students to test again if they fail three times. This includes testing which may have occurred at other testing sites for all program types.
- We will only accept TEAS scores taken at OCC. Students cannot transfer in TEAS scores from other testing facilities.
- Passing score is based on the student proficiency score. The score is set by the School of Nursing and can be changed without notification.
